This postcard depicts La Plage de Rougerais in Saint-Jacut-de-la-Mer, a coastal commune in the Côtes-d'Armor department of Brittany, France. The image captures a relaxed beach scene where elegantly dressed families and bathers enjoy a sunny day by the sea.
Saint-Jacut-de-la-Mer, situated on a narrow peninsula jutting into the English Channel, has long been cherished for its unspoiled beaches and traditional Breton charm. In the early 20th century, seaside holidays became popular among the French middle and upper classes, and the beaches of Brittany were ideal for healthful retreats.
The reverse follows the Carte Postale format with space for correspondence and address.
Front Text: "176 – Saint-Jacut-de-la-Mer (C.-du-N.) – La Plage de Rougerais – Edit. Passebecq, Dinan."
